public KVMPhysicalDisk getPhysicalDisk(String volumeUuid, KVMStoragePool pool) {
LibvirtStoragePool libvirtPool = (LibvirtStoragePool)pool;

/*
* An RBD volume is looked up through librbd rather than through libvirt.
* A volume that was created by another host is not in the libvirt pool
* cache, so looking it up through libvirt misses and forces a refresh of
* the whole pool. Refreshing an RBD pool stats every image in it, so that
* cost grows with the number of volumes in the pool and is paid on every
* VM start. Every other RBD operation in this class already uses librbd
* directly.
*/
if (pool.getType() == StoragePoolType.RBD) {
return getRbdPhysicalDisk(volumeUuid, libvirtPool);
}

try {
StorageVol vol = getVolume(libvirtPool.getPool(), volumeUuid);
KVMPhysicalDisk disk;

/**
* Looks an RBD volume up directly through librbd.
*
* The size reported by librbd is used for both the size and the virtual size of
* the disk, matching what this class already does after converting an image into
* an RBD volume.
*/
private KVMPhysicalDisk getRbdPhysicalDisk(String volumeUuid, LibvirtStoragePool pool) {
Rados r = new Rados(pool.getAuthUserName());
try {
r.confSet("mon_host", pool.getSourceHost() + ":" + pool.getSourcePort());
/*
* The secret is null when the pool has no cephx user, and librados
* aborts the process rather than returning an error if it is handed a
* null value here.
*/
if (pool.getAuthUserName() != null) {
r.confSet("key", pool.getAuthSecret());
} else {
r.confSet("auth_client_required", "none");
}
r.confSet("client_mount_timeout", "30");
r.connect();

IoCTX io = r.ioCtxCreate(pool.getSourceDir());
try {
Rbd rbd = new Rbd(io);
// The image is only stat'ed, so it is opened read only and cannot take the exclusive lock.
RbdImage image = rbd.openReadOnly(volumeUuid);
try {
RbdImageInfo rbdInfo = image.stat();
KVMPhysicalDisk disk = new KVMPhysicalDisk(pool.getSourceDir() + "/" + volumeUuid, volumeUuid, pool);
disk.setFormat(PhysicalDiskFormat.RAW);
disk.setSize(rbdInfo.size);
disk.setVirtualSize(rbdInfo.size);
return disk;
} finally {
closeRbdImage(rbd, image, volumeUuid);
}
} finally {
r.ioCtxDestroy(io);
}
} catch (RadosException e) {
logger.error("A Ceph RADOS operation failed (" + e.getReturnValue() + "). The error was: " + e.getMessage()
+ " - " + ErrorCode.getErrorMessage(e.getReturnValue()));
throw new CloudRuntimeException(e.toString(), e);
} catch (RbdException e) {
logger.error("A Ceph RBD operation failed (" + e.getReturnValue() + "). The error was: " + e.getMessage()
+ " - " + ErrorCode.getErrorMessage(e.getReturnValue()));
throw new CloudRuntimeException(e.toString(), e);
} finally {
r.shutDown();
}
}

/**
* Closes an RBD image without throwing, so that a failure to close cannot discard a
* successful result or hide the exception that is already on its way out.
*/
private void closeRbdImage(Rbd rbd, RbdImage image, String volumeUuid) {
try {
rbd.close(image);
} catch (RbdException e) {
logger.warn("Failed to close RBD image " + volumeUuid + " (" + e.getReturnValue() + "): "
+ e.getMessage() + " - " + ErrorCode.getErrorMessage(e.getReturnValue()));
}
}
